What s random fertilization?

The random combination of chromosomes resulting from pairing up 1 of the 8.4 million possible chromosome combinations of a sperm with 1 of the 8.4 million possibly chromosome combinations of the egg (due to independent assortment of chromosomes during Meiosis. This comes out to about 70 trillion combinations, which does not even factor in the crossing over of genetic material during Meiosis.

What effects does union of haploids in fertilization have on genetic diversity?

Fertilization is random and the haploids are male and female gametes, sperm and eggs. So, genetic diversity is enhanced greatly because random fertilization comes after the independent orientation of male and female chromosomes plus crossing over in meiosis. So, statistically speaking, there are myriad variations that can come out of haploid random fertilization and so great genetic diversity is also enhanced here.

How do you calculate gene combinations for a given set of genes?

For just random assortment, there are 2 to the power of the number if pairs of chromosomes. In humans, it's 2 to the 23 power. Recombination and random fertilization create even more variations but can not be calculated.
